Output d5a3b62c50e9640cc01974852fc397a8e191e666b5be6036a43fe6ac251f5e63:1

value
142576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8dcd282faee58bc8db84290669ed1d8eaf620b4b OP_EQUALVERIFY OP_CHECKSIG
address
1Dvn3c5X1QhQ7qS1h81nJuAhxJMXyoTX6j
transaction
d5a3b62c50e9640cc01974852fc397a8e191e666b5be6036a43fe6ac251f5e63
confirmations
346474
spent
true